如何在MATLAB中实现雨流计数法来分析疲劳载荷数据,并结合最小二乘法进行疲劳寿命预测?请提供实现的步骤和示例代码。
时间: 2024-11-07 15:27:47 浏览: 36
在工程仿真和数据分析领域,准确地分析和预测材料在疲劳载荷作用下的行为至关重要。MATLAB提供了一个强大的平台来实现这一点,特别是结合雨流计数法和最小二乘法。首先,需要在MATLAB中导入载荷数据,然后利用雨流计数法来简化和分析载荷历程。在MATLAB中实现雨流计数法,可以通过编写相应的脚本来自动化这一过程,脚本中会包括查找极值点、匹配闭合回路等逻辑。完成雨流计数分析后,得到的载荷循环数据可以用来进行疲劳寿命的预测。此时,最小二乘法在此步骤中发挥作用,通过拟合实验数据和已知的S-N曲线(应力-寿命曲线),可以估计材料的疲劳寿命。下面是一个简化的步骤和示例代码:(步骤、代码、mermaid流程图、扩展内容,此处略)在这个过程中,通过使用MATLAB的矩阵运算和内置函数,可以有效处理大量数据并进行复杂的计算。为了帮助你更好地理解和应用这些方法,强烈推荐查阅《MATLAB中雨流计数法与最小二乘法在疲劳断裂分析的应用》。这份资源详细讲解了雨流计数法和最小二乘法的具体实现,还包括了实际应用中的案例研究和示例代码,是深入学习和应用这些技术的理想选择。在你掌握了这些基础之后,你可以进一步探索MATLAB的其他工具箱,以进行更高级的仿真和数据分析。
参考资源链接:[MATLAB中雨流计数法与最小二乘法在疲劳断裂分析的应用](https://wenku.csdn.net/doc/6zzcz6o493?spm=1055.2569.3001.10343)
阅读全文